Amazon's Leo Satellite Business Takes Off Amid Starlink Dominance

Amazon's Leo satellite business is gaining traction despite Starlink's dominance in the Low-Earth Orbit (LEO) satellite market.

The company has secured strategic partnerships, offered competitive pricing, and leveraged advanced technology to gain ground.

Bank of America has raised Amazon's price target to $310, projecting Leo could generate $7-10 billion in annual recurring revenue by 2030.

This figure is substantial, but it's not the only significant aspect of this development. Integration with Amazon's AWS and Prime services could further enhance revenue and ecosystem growth over the next decade.
